- [ ] Step 7: Archive cold storage buckets (Glacierline tier). Confirm both ceremony witnesses are present, verify bucket manifests match the Oxbow ledger, then seal the archive key shares. Plugin authors may observe but not handle shares. Once sealed, the archive index itself is encrypted and can only be reopened with the passphrase below.

vault phrase of badup-hahig = tamael-aldael-kelmir-istael-fenok-istwyn-tamius-jorath-oliion

Handover — Q2 Cash-Flow Forecast

Rennick to Oyelale. Forecast model is in the shared ledger; assumptions tab updated last week. Key items: Bravent receivable slips to June, Karstowe capex deferred, payroll uplift from May. Downside case shows a tight August — keep the revolver headroom flagged. Weekly reforecast cadence holds until further notice. Context for the numbers is in the confidential note below.

confidential, fahip-bagep: The southern region missed its Holwyn quota by 21.5 percent last quarter. Sorvanek Foods plans to raise the Jorir list price by 23.9 percent in December. The pricing group signed off on a budget of $411.6 million for Project Eliion. The renewal with Juldorix Works closes at $87.9 million a year, 16.8 percent below the last contract.

Welcome aboard! We're migrating the old cron jobs on Pipework over to the Loomshed workflow engine, mostly so retries and fan-out stop being duct tape. Capacity-wise, peak load is the nightly reconciliation burst, so we sized worker pools around that. Don't tweak these without pinging the platform channel. Current tuning constants for the Loomshed workers are as follows:

constants for bawif-kawif:
QUOTAS = {
    "ulaael": 5,
    "holael": 10,
}

14:22 — Brambleton cleanup bot deleted twelve branches still referenced by open reviews. Root cause: the staleness query ignored draft reviews. Bot paused at 14:31. Branches restored from reflog by 15:05. New members: never re-enable the bot without the guard flag. Fix merged same day. The patched bot build is identified by the token below.

session token of tajef-bageg = htk21_5d90d574934f3ccae6437